The ISO 17712 certification holds significant importance in the realm of international trade and transportation security. This certification serves as a global standard for the security of cargo containers, ensuring that they remain tamper-evident and secure throughout their journey. In Canada, obtaining the ISO 17712 certification is not only a demonstration of commitment to secure trade practices but also a crucial step towards enhancing the country’s role in the global supply chain.
The ISO 17712 certification specifically addresses the need for secure container seals, which play a vital role in safeguarding goods during transit. These seals provide evidence of any tampering or unauthorized access, reducing the risk of theft, smuggling, and other illicit activities that can compromise the integrity of the cargo and disrupt the supply chain. In a country as vast and interconnected as Canada, where goods are transported by land, sea, and air, maintaining the security of cargo containers is of paramount importance.
Obtaining ISO 17712 certification involves a rigorous process that evaluates various aspects of container security. Manufacturers of container seals must adhere to stringent guidelines and quality control measures to produce seals that meet the certification requirements. These seals are tested for their strength, durability, and resistance to tampering techniques. Additionally, the certification process involves thorough documentation and auditing to ensure that the manufacturing and distribution processes align with the ISO 17712 standards.
For Canadian businesses involved in international trade, ISO 17712 certification offers several key benefits:
- Global Acceptance: ISO 17712 is recognized and accepted worldwide. Canadian businesses with this certification can seamlessly participate in global trade, as their container seals will be trusted by customs authorities, shipping lines, and trading partners across different countries.
- Risk Mitigation: By using ISO 17712 certified seals, Canadian exporters can significantly reduce the risk of cargo theft, pilferage, and tampering. This helps in maintaining the quality and quantity of goods being transported and prevents financial losses.
- Regulatory Compliance: Many countries have regulations in place that mandate the use of ISO 17712 certified seals for certain types of cargo. By obtaining this certification, Canadian businesses can ensure compliance with international trade regulations.
- Enhanced Reputation: ISO 17712 certification reflects a commitment to security and professionalism. Canadian companies with this certification are viewed as reliable and responsible trade partners, enhancing their reputation in the global market.
- Supply Chain Efficiency: Secure container seals contribute to the smooth flow of goods within the supply chain. Delays due to security breaches or disputes can be minimized, ensuring timely delivery of goods.
- Customs Facilitation: Customs authorities are more likely to expedite the clearance process for containers with ISO 17712 certified seals, leading to faster and smoother customs procedures.
